Structure and Working Principle
The IRFHM830TRPBF utilizes a vertical MOSFET structure with a trench gate design. This architecture allows for lower on-resistance (RDS(on)) compared to planar MOSFETs, improving efficiency in high-current applications. When a sufficient gate-to-source voltage is applied, it creates a conductive channel between the drain and source terminals. The component can switch rapidly between conducting and non-conducting states, making it suitable for pulse-width modulated (PWM) control circuits common in power electronics.

Maintenance and Precautions
Proper heat sinking is essential for maximizing the lifespan of the IRFHM830TRPBF. The junction temperature should not exceed 175°C during operation, with derating recommended for high ambient temperatures. Static electricity precautions must be observed during handling. The gate oxide can be damaged by electrostatic discharge (ESD), so proper grounding procedures should be followed during installation and maintenance.
